Camshaft Timing Oil Control Valve: Inspection

  1. REMOVE CAMSHAFT TIMING OIL CONTROL VALVE (OCV) 
    1. Disconnect the OCV connector.
    2. Remove the bolt and OCV.
    3. Remove the O-ring from the OCV.

  2. INSPECT CAMSHAFT TIMING OIL CONTROL VALVE (OCV) OPERATION 

    Connect the battery's positive (+) lead to terminal 1 and negative (-) lead to terminal 2. Check the movement of the valve as shown in Fig 2 and Fig 3.

    If operation is not as specified, replace the OCV.

  3. REINSTALL CAMSHAFT OIL CONTROL VALVE (OCV) 
    1. Install a new O-ring to the OCV.
    2. Install the OCV completely, and tighten the bolt.

      Torque: 9.0 N.m (90 kgf.cm, 80 in.lbf) 

    3. Connect the OCV connector.
